Samuel Ogden was born in Cumberland County New Jersey and remain there for his life. Is not able to find much about his Revolutionary War service is grave is marked as a Soldier of the Revolution
Location type: Single Grave

Date of Death: January 10, 1805

Cause of death: Died Later

Grave Marker Text:
In Memory of SAMUEL OGDEN Esquire who departed this life the 10th day of January Anno Domini 1805, in the 72nd year of his age
